BMX Cologne 2016 Highlights

July 11, 2016

Freedom BMX coming through with a highlight reel from this years BMX Cologne contest that went down the other weekend over in Germany! This video is packed full of riding from the spine ramp and street course to flatland and some of the good times that were had off the bikes. Real good watch from start to finish! Check it!

BMX Worlds 2015 Cancelled

April 16, 2015

bmxcgn-logo

First Vans Kill The Line gets postponed until 2016 and now today we caught wind that the BMX Cologne (formerly BMX Worlds) has been cancelled as well! It sounds like the guys behind the BMX Cologne contest have simply run out of room to make the event happen and are looking for ways to find a way to do it to its fullest potential. Here’s the official word…

“After 30 years of BMX in the “Kölner Jugendpark” our motivation to organize this event has not changed. We always were driven by the passion for our sport BMX. To provide a platform where BMX is recognized as a sport and culture rather than a circus or stunt-show has always been in our focus. To show the variety that BMX has to offer has always been a main part of our concept. BMX at the Jugendpark has become a ritual to us and to thousands of BMX lovers from all over the world.

In 2015 the BMX CGN will take a break. It’s time for a concept overhaul and to give the venue the opportunity to improve its infrastructure to secure the future of BMX at this very special location. Since 2011 we have been facing higher standards and restrictions set by the City of Cologne year by year. Now it has reached a level that makes it impossible for us to proceed the way we did it in the past. We were working on solutions, but for this year’s event we are running out of time.

Nevertheless, we wish you an awesome BMX summer!! Thank you for the support over the last years & keep on riding!!

Your BMX CGN Crew
